Telemetry gateway runbook, Harrowlink v3. If combine units stop reporting, check the ingest pods first; restarts are safe and idempotent. Next, verify the uplink broker accepts connections on the standard port. Packet backlogs above 50k mean the parser is wedged — redeploy it. All manual probes against the internal ingest API require authentication. Use the maintainer key below.

service key, fawip-bajef: kto11_Qt5wZK9vdNC

**Step 4 — Connection pooling (Quillbarn deploy):** Set the pooler to transaction mode and cap connections at 40 per replica; the Brindle cluster falls over above that. Verify pool health via the dashboard before promoting. Once metrics look stable for ten minutes, sign the release manifest so the deploy daemon will accept it. Use the deploy key shown directly below this step.

deploy key for kahof-tadup: bky4_rRMZ

# Closure: Ashfern Office — Managers Only

The Ashfern satellite office will close at the end of next quarter. Headcount of nine: six relocate to Dunmoor, three offered remote roles. Lease terminates without penalty. Client coverage transfers to the Dunmoor branch with no service changes. Keep communications internal until HR completes notifications. Broader rationale is set out in the confidential note below.

board note of kajeg-bahof: Holdorix Works plans to lower the Briius list price by 11.6 percent in September. The pricing group signed off on a budget of $499.9 million for Project Holdor. The renewal with Fraokix Group closes at $129.5 million a year, 50.2 percent above the last contract. Project Tameth slips by one quarter because of the tooling delay.

Subject: Handover — Paylark export format change

Hi, welcome aboard. The payroll export for Paylark moved from fixed-width to delimited CSV in release 4.2, so the downstream validator at Finch & Row now expects a header row and ISO dates. Please double-check the mapping spec before your first cut, and run the dry-run exporter against staging. Exports must be signed before upload; use the key directly below.

signing key of bagap-yawep = bky13_TbfT6ZMUoGJo2